Awkwardness & Grace
19 episodes - English - Latest episode: over 3 years ago -Conversations with humans about race. As a white mom with two beautiful black boys I have been frozen into silence when it comes to talking about race. It is deeply awkward but I realize I can no longer ignore this privilege and have stepped up by inviting parents, thought leaders, educators and the weary to talk about race and the awkwardness and grace of it all.

Talking race to kids 5 and under
July 03, 2020 23:15 - 28 minutes - 25.9 MBBooks for children http://hereweeread.com/2017/11/2018-ultimate-list-diverse-childrens-books.html Social Justice Books website https://socialjusticebooks.org/booklists/slavery/ Age 2+: Lovely by Jess Hong. We’re Different We’re the Same by Bobbi Kates. Ages 3-4 years: Is There a Human Race? Harper Collins,Canada. The Skin You Live In by Michael Tyler. Mailika's Costume , Groundwood Books. All the Colors of the Earth by Sheila Hamanaka. Ages 4+ All Are Welcome by Alexandra Penfol...
